BYPASSING DOT NET VALIDATEREQUEST PDF

There have been some different ways to bypass this previously like . ProCheckUp Research; has realised a new security note Bypassing ” ValidateRequest” for Script Injection Attacks. This article introduces script injection payloads that bypass ValidateRequest filter and also details the hit and trial procedures to.

Author: Zulkisho Vusida
Country: Venezuela
Language: English (Spanish)
Genre: Art
Published (Last): 27 November 2015
Pages: 426
PDF File Size: 4.67 Mb
ePub File Size: 10.26 Mb
ISBN: 745-2-34287-790-1
Downloads: 66389
Price: Free* [*Free Regsitration Required]
Uploader: Moogutaur

Post Your Answer Discard By clicking “Post Your Answer”, you acknowledge that you have read our updated terms of serviceprivacy policy and cookie hypassingand that your continued use of the website is subject to these policies. Sign up using Facebook.

Vlaidaterequest the filter been continued or is it right to discontinue. Also would like to know, which would be the better way to pass db query: A potentially dangerous Request.

But since fixing vulnerabilities has a real cost, one must be able to make the business case for the fix i. By clicking “Post Your Answer”, you acknowledge that you have read our updated terms of serviceprivacy policy and cookie policyand that your continued use of the website is subject to these policies. Sunday, 1 June Bypassing asp. Email Required, but never shown. The same error page is shown. NET’s Request Validation will not prevent the injection of payloads.

By using our site, you acknowledge that you have read and understand our Cookie PolicyPrivacy Policyand our Terms of Service. The Unicode payload validateerquest bypass ValidateRequest filter. Validdaterequest encode your content to make it XSS safe, encode the string, like: The ValidateRequest filter blocks request if any alpha a-z, A-Z or certain special characters — i.

  JADEED FIQHI MASAIL PDF

You are commenting using your WordPress. Home Questions Tags Users Unanswered. NET framework 4 also but even if you try to activate the filter, it will not allow you to do so. Se the code below: To activate Validaterequest in. ValidateRequest is present in ASP.

I think a more interesting and relevant question is: I’m testing an application where the application does not handle special characters but request validation in ASP. Validateerquest are commenting using your Twitter account.

Bypassing ASP .NET “ValidateRequest” for Script Injection Attacks –

NET considers the submitted request potentially malicious:. This site uses cookies. A lot of research and experience. NET ValidateRequest filter and also details the hit and trial procedures to analyze. This ultimately means that tests to ensure that applications have been written following secure programming guidelines can be invalidated.

The above tests show validaterequrst importance of output sanitization for preventing cross site scripting attacks. Habeeb 3, 1 18 NET version 4 does not use the ValidateRequest filter. To see that in action, we can use this payload bypassiing popup an alert: Post as a guest Name. In this case, it seems that the risk of exploitation is quite low for reflected XSS, but if there is an persistent XSS vuln, then the.

Another Request Validation Bypass? NET picks it up and throws an exception.

[WEB SECURITY] PR08-20: Bypassing ASP .NET “ValidateRequest” for Script Injection Attacks

Newer Post Older Post Home. Submit the Unicode string as input in text field:. Post Your Answer Discard By clicking “Post Your Answer”, you acknowledge that you have read our updated terms of serviceprivacy policy and cookie policyand that your continued use of the website is subject to these policies.

  2 GPSGV PDF

If this type of input is appropriate in your application, you can include code in a web page to explicitly allow it. NET considers the submitted request potentially malicious: The data might represent an attempt to compromise the security of your application, such as a cross-site scripting attack.

There have been some different ways to bypass this previously like these links show: By clicking “Post Your Answer”, you acknowledge that you have read our updated terms of serviceprivacy policy and cookie policyand that your continued use of the website is subject to these policies. Defence in Depth is a good strategy, specially since part of its core principles is the idea that some of the security measures applied will fail. What is the replacement of ValidateRequest in version 4.

NET versions 1, 2 and 3. Menu Skip to content.

XSS vulns tend to be caused by specific coding patterns, and usually when there is one, there is a high probability that more will exists.